Simplified Rules for Using Fire Hydrant Water
Every withdrawal of water from a fire hydrant must be permitted, metered and paid for. There are no exceptions; everyone pays their water bill, including City Hall, City departments, City contractors, City subs, and utility contractors installing water lines. This is why it is illegal to take water from fire hydrants without permission – besides the safety factor – if you are using the hydrant, then the fire department will have harder access to the hydrant and your illegal use can lower the water pressure in the system causing other hydrants to have less pressure.
